This post is full time and permanent, working 35 hours per week.

The University has an exciting opportunity for an information compliance professional to join our supportive and welcoming team and play a leading role in developing and delivering an effective information compliance framework in support of the University’s business and risk strategies.

As Information Compliance Manager, you will be the named Freedom of Information Officer and Data Protection Officer for the University. You will be our technical specialist, providing advice and guidance to university colleagues, managers and committees at all levels on the requirements of Freedom of Information, Environmental Information and Data Protection legislation, liaising with the Information Commissioner’s Office (ICO) as required.

You will join an effective multidisciplinary department that works with different colleagues across the University. You will work in partnership with colleagues in the Information Systems and Support and the Archives and Records Management teams to promote good information compliance across the University.

You should have a sound understanding and knowledge of relevant legislation and experience of developing and implementing organisational policies and procedures in relevant areas. You should also have excellent communication and inter-personal skills, experience of managing a team, and a solution-focused approach to your work. Working with busy teams, you will need to be able to prioritise tasks, work to tight deadlines and be flexible to changing workloads.

You will be based in Central London and we have a Smart Working approach that allows for some remote working in the UK when you are not required onsite.
